20 June 2008
AN overdue yacht participating in the annual Bergen to Shetland race has been
spotted 18 miles southeast off Lerwick.
The Lerwick lifeboat has now been launched to provide an escort to the 21ft
Paradis which has two crew on board.
A full scale search was launched last night after the yacht failed to arrive at
Lerwick Harbour. The last contact with the crew had been at 2pm on Wednesday,
shortly after she had left Bergen.
This morning, a spokesman for Shetland Coastguard said the yacht at been spotted
by an Nimrod aircraft at 7.30am and everybody on board was safe and well.
The escort is expected to arrive in Lerwick Harbour at around 3pm.
